Contracts

Contracts are an important way to describe the expectations, rights and obligations between parties in a business arrangement.  When properly constructed, contracts are enforceable by the courts. So from the beginning, it is important that both parties understand exactly what it is they are signing and what liabilities that may carry.

If you are running a business, it is important that you use the right contract language to preserve your legal rights and limit your exposure to liability.
